In this episode of Spiritual Hot Sauce, Chris Jones explores the deep-rooted connection between our biology and our beats with Micah Voraritskul, author of Human is the New Vinyl. We move past the technical hype to discuss the spiritual importance of music as a communal expression of the human experience—something an algorithm can simulate but never "feel." From the ancient Kesh Temple hymn to the modern vinyl resurgence, we examine how humanity was literally built through song and why outsourcing our creativity to AI risks robbing us of our human dignity. This conversation is a call to return to the "inconvenient" beauty of analog life, reminding us that we are designed to live in rhythms, not algorithms, following intuition over computation to preserve the very things that make us us.
